done time execution for queries, query by counter of job, total in column in query...
[proteocache.git] / server / compbio / listeners / LengthServlet.java
index 533e6e1..8bcc886 100644 (file)
@@ -24,6 +24,7 @@ public class LengthServlet extends HttpServlet {
         *      response)
         */
        protected void doGet(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Exception {
+               final long startTime = System.currentTimeMillis();
                String date1 = request.getParameter("data1");
                String date2 = request.getParameter("data2");
                StatisticsProt sp = new StatisticsProt();
@@ -36,6 +37,8 @@ public class LengthServlet extends HttpServlet {
                request.setAttribute("data2", date2);
                request.setAttribute("result", sp.readLength(date1, date2));
                request.setAttribute("flag", request.getParameter("option"));
+               final long endTime = System.currentTimeMillis();
+               request.setAttribute("timeExecution", (endTime - startTime));
                RequestDispatcher rd = request.getRequestDispatcher("/ReportLength.jsp");
                rd.forward(request, response);
        }